The Wrestling Federation of India (WFI) has announced a one-year suspension for Aman Sehrawat after he failed to make the required weight at the World Wrestling Championships. Sehrawat was disqualified from the event after weighing in 1.7 kilograms over his category limit, a significant setback for the wrestler and the Indian contingent.
Details of the Suspension
The suspension comes as a strict enforcement of international wrestling rules, which mandate athletes to meet specific weight criteria to compete fairly. Sehrawat’s disqualification not only ended his participation in the World Championships but also bars him from competing in upcoming events for an entire year.

Official Statements and Future Measures
A WFI spokesperson emphasized the necessity of discipline and adherence to weight regulations, stating that the suspension acts as a message to all athletes. Additionally, Sehrawat’s coach acknowledged the need for strict protocols and commitment to weight management.
In response to this event, the WFI plans to enhance its support systems to better assist athletes in maintaining their fitness and weight requirements, aiming to prevent similar issues in the future.
